How to simplify 24/10?

Simplifying a fraction (reducing it to the lowest terms), such as 24/10, means expressing the same value more clearly and concisely.

Step-by-step simplification of 24/10

  1. Start with computing the GCD of 24 and 10: GCD(24, 10) = 2.
  2. Divide the numerator by the GCD: 24/2 = 12
  3. Divide the denominator by the GCD: 10/2 = 5
  4. Combine these results to form the new simplified fraction: 12/5

The final result is: 24 10 = 12 5
